Houndin’ the Streets March 28th, 2015 Glitch Closing Party

Mar 28 at 11:00pm to Mar 29 at 3:00am
At the Flying Duck, 142 Renfield Street, Glasgow G2 3AU
‘We are a glitch in the system / Our lives deny the lies
Our complexity is dissent / We fight for love’
Houndin’ Saturday 28th March is not only Houndin’ Saturday 28th March but also the closing party for Glitch Film Festival.
“GLITCH is a queer, trans, intersex, people of colour film festival. A contemporary snapshot of queer passions and preoccupations. Road movies, love, prisons, BDSM, colonialism, dance, death, lipstick, racism, shop work, night life, outer space, sex work, ancient rites, pride, mothers & children, pet dogs and more!”
Suits Houndin’ just fine… Glitch are giving the Duck a bit of a makeover on the night, Jer and myself will bring the usual eclectic and exquisite noise… maybe even some Glitch djs too…
Go to some films, come and dance at the party…
